Prince Lanling-Gao Changgong was an important general in the late Northern Qi Dynasty, who taken part in the all important battle between North Qi and North Zhou on the last time of Notrh Qi.Prince Lanling was described as a famous general, who was in charge of security of nation in many folklore and historians’thesis. But author don’t agree with that. Through the analysis of historical data, the author concluded that Prince Lanling wasn’t a military elite but with some military abilities. In fact, he was a brave general.Although Prince Lanling’s ability is not in the same level with Duan Shao and Hu Lv Guang, however, the reason that he get the similar status like them in the army is that his rise was manipulated by the loyal family, who lack of general, to protect he central state power from being grabbed by other nobilities. Because of the royal family lack of general who captain of war.Because of the contradiction between Emperor’s power and Prince’s status, Emperor took action to weaken his influence. The strengthened central state power and the national conflicts, have resulted in his tragic fate inevitably.Although, Prince Lanling had a tragic fate., he became a famous general in the bottom heart of people. The reason for this is people remold him. Firstly, The Song of Lanling defeated enemy, was sung and accepted by the two nations, which has propelled him in a further way. Secondly, Prince Lanling, who has both Han and Xianbei national characteristics, had exactly adapted to the trend of that time which was in the process of national amalgamation. In addition, historian’s description and culture transformation were the reason, too.
